    Sparta — International Salon and Spa of Sparta has pulled out all the stops to raise funds for children of America's heroes, and celebrate the launch of a "Profound Beauty" innovation. From noon-4 p.m. on Sunday, Sept. 11, the salon will provide hair cutting, nail and rejuvenating massage services, with all proceeds supporting the Freedom Alliance Scholarship Fund. The fund provides educational scholarships to the children of Americans in the armed forces who have sacrificed life or limb for their country. Local invited military leaders will be on hand to share empowering messages. The salon will be offering cuts at $25, manicures at $10, and massages at $1 per minute with a 10 minute minimum.
